The Ebola crisis is growing, requiring a massive emergency response. The National Center for Disaster Preparedness (NCDP), in collaboration with the Earth Institute, will bring together experts and stakeholders for a timely, educational conference on the outbreak. This multi-disciplinary dialogue will focus on how best to curb the epidemic, understand its impacts——particularly in terms of bioethical and sustainability implications—— and mitigate future high-fatality events.

Hosts: Jeffrey D. Sachs, The Earth Institute, Columbia University; Irwin Redlener, MD, National Center for Disaster Preparedness, The Earth Institute, Columbia University.
